Description
AMERICAN SCHOOL (19TH CENTURY) FOLK ART STILL-LIFE PAINTING, oil on canvas, an outstanding example, richly detailed and vibrant in coloration, depicting a bountiful harvest of flowers, strawberries, grapes, pears, and apples, along with a glass of milk on a shaped marble top, no signature located, remnants of 19th century framer's label attached verso. Housed in a 19th century molded-wood frame with ebonized surface. Third quarter 19th century. 37 3/4" x 29 3/4" sight, 45" x 37 1/2" OA.
Very good original condition on original stretchers with scattered minor craquelure and surface abrasions, very small puncture (1/2" diameter) with old patch lower right corner. Very minor scattered inpainting to background. Frame with possibly later surface.
Provenance: Property from a New York City and Richmond, VA private estate collection.
